Introduction

• Starburst = short-lived intense period of star formation that is unsustainable over the Hubble time due to the limited supply of gas within a galaxy (McQuinn + 2010); generally, interactions/mergers are triggers

• Dwarf Galaxy = low luminosity, low mass system, contained in a dark matter halo; believed to be the “Building Blocks” of larger galaxies

• Starburst Dwarf Galaxy = possibly a “Building Block” in action? What is the role of interactions/mergers between dwarf galaxies?

Summary

• NGC 1569 is a thick disk– Vmax/σz = 2.4 ± 0.7– Stars and gas kinematically follow each other– Extended HI emission to south and northeast of

NGC 1569 in VLA map stretching in the direction of UGCA 92 and confirmed with GBT

• NGC 4163/4214– “Unsettled” HI in VLA maps– Possible extended emission detected in GBT map
